This practice looks after your medical record in accordance with the laws on data protection and confidentiality.
We share medical records with those who are involved in providing you with care and treatment. You have the right to object to your medical records being shared with those who provide you with care.
In some circumstances, we will also share medical records for medical research and to plan health services. You have the right to object to your information being used for medical research and to plan health services.
We share information when the law requires us to do so, for example, to prevent infectious diseases from spreading or to check the care being provided to you is safe.
You have the right to be given a copy of your medical record.
You have the right to have any mistakes corrected.
You have the right to complain to the Information Commissioner’s Office.
